Battle Royale Games

The best game ?

Submitted by Pasmoi, , Thread ID: 241259

RE: The best game ?

#26
Fortnite definitely isn't what it used to be but it's probably still the best battle royale at the moment.

Users browsing this thread: 11 Guest(s)